Skip to content

Commit

Permalink
Loging success message on mutation test success
Browse files Browse the repository at this point in the history
  • Loading branch information
dsandeephegde committed Nov 6, 2017
1 parent 5366264 commit 5cc498d
Showing 1 changed file with 4 additions and 1 deletion.
5 changes: 4 additions & 1 deletion python/servo/mutation/test.py
Expand Up @@ -40,10 +40,13 @@ def mutation_test(file_name, tests):
test_command = "python mach test-wpt {0} --release".format(test.encode('utf-8'))
test_status = subprocess.call(test_command, shell=True, stdout=DEVNULL)
if test_status != 0:
print("Failed in while running `{0}`".format(test_command))
print("Failed: while running `{0}`".format(test_command))
print "mutated file {0} diff".format(file_name)
sys.stdout.flush()
subprocess.call('git --no-pager diff {0}'.format(file_name), shell=True)
else:
print("Success: Mutation killed by {0}".format(test.encode('utf-8')))
break
print "reverting mutant {0}:{1}".format(file_name, line_to_mutate)
sys.stdout.flush()
subprocess.call('git checkout {0}'.format(file_name), shell=True)

0 comments on commit 5cc498d

Please sign in to comment.